Expert Witnesses

Expert witnesses are an essential component of any lawsuit and asbestos cases are no different. Attorneys representing those who have been diagnosed with mesothelioma, or other diseases caused by exposure to asbestos, are required to rely on a variety of experts to back their case. This could include industrial hygiene specialists medical doctors, asbestos specialists.

An experienced asbestos lawyer has professional relationships with several experts who can provide crucial testimony. They will also be acquainted with the types of questions they may be asked during depositions and can prepare them to answer these questions in a way that will make them more credible in the eyes of a jury.

Many asbestos experts have testified in dozens or hundreds of cases. Their knowledge of the procedure of giving testimony in such complex cases makes them more efficient and efficient, and they be able to effectively give their evidence to the jury.

An asbestos lawyer's role is to ensure that their clients receive the amount they deserve. This requires various expert witnesses. They must determine the severity and nature of the illness that affected the victims, as well as the impact that these illnesses affected their lives. Experts in this field can aid in this endeavor by looking over the medical records of the victim as well as conducting tests and analyzing their employment history.

The asbestos attorneys may also consult with other experts in areas such as environmental, engineering failure analysis indoor air quality and insurance. These experts can write reports regarding asbestos-related hazards, asbestos analysis and asbestos removal. They may also testify at trial and/or serve as consulting (non-testifying) experts in asbestos cases.

Expert witnesses play an essential role in every litigants, but they're particularly crucial in instances where legal and medical issues are complex. Plaintiffs' attorneys rely on these experts to strengthen their arguments and convince jurors to side with them. It is essential for defense counsel to identify the experts and verify prior to bringing them into litigation. This will help avoid a successful Daubert challenge that can weaken a defendant's position in the trial.

Documentation

A mesothelioma lawyer will collect medical records, work history and other relevant details to create a strong case. They will also establish where you first came into contact with asbestos, and whether exposure to asbestos could have led to mesothelioma or asbestosis. They will assist you obtain the evidence necessary to file an asbestos lawsuit or trust fund claim.

A mesothelioma lawyer will ensure that you receive the compensation to you are entitled. They will ensure that any compensation you receive will be used to pay your funeral expenses, medical bills, lost income and other costs due to your asbestos-related disease. They will fight for any additional compensation that you may be entitled to.

They will investigate to identify the parties responsible. This will include asbestos companies responsible for your exposure, and could even include other companies that were involved in the manufacture of dangerous asbestos-containing products. This step is critical since mesothelioma is known to have a long latency period and it is often difficult to determine the exact source of your exposure.

During the process of discovery, your lawyer will obtain important documents from the defendants as evidence that their negligence caused your injury. This is a vital element of any successful legal case and can play an important part in settlement negotiations. If a defendant can be shown to have been aware of asbestos' dangers but did nothing about it and did not take action, they will likely be more willing to settle your case than take your case to trial.
